John "Jack" Terhune was a native of Passaic, NJ. He moved to Roseville in 1919 where he worked as a locomotive engineer for the Southern Pacific Railroad for 45 years, retiring in 1964.

Jack was a U.S. Army veteran of World War II and a member of the Roseville post of the American Legion, local division of Brothers of Locomotive Engineers, and the Roseville branch of Sons in Retirement.

Jack was survived by his wife Mary Colnar Terhune, son, Clarence Terhune of Ione, daughter-in-law, Ardyce Terhune, and granddaughters, Melanie and Allison.
